  • How can i delete a photo album that has been synced from another computer

    I am trying to delete a photo album that I do not need anymore from an iPad 4. But the album has been synced from a computer that I don't have access to anymore. Is there anyway around this ?

    Photos that were synced from a computer can only be deleted by connecting to a computer's iTunes and changing the sync selection on the device's Photos tab.
    Is that the only album that was synced from that computer (and you now sync the iPad to a different computer ?), or do you have other albums from it that you want to keep on the iPad ? If you want to keep one or more albums on it then they will need to be on the computer that you sync to so that they can be selected on the Photos tab and re-copied to the iPad from that computer. If you want to remove all synced photos then try selecting and syncing just an empty folder

  • Updating to FF 4 yesterday completely wiped out my entire browsing history -- and started again from scratch as of yesterday. This is an extremely alarming, disappointing, upsetting discovery!!! Is there any way to restore / recover what was lost?

    I went to "History" & found EVERYTHING wiped out & started again from scratch after d/loading new FF version. Most people are rabid about CLEARING History, but I use mine extensively. Finding it gone was not welcome. Any way to fix / recover this?

    I had this problem but when downgrading from FF4 to FF3.6. I was able to recover everything, so maybe the solution is the same.
    [[Profiles|Find your profile folder...]]<br/>
    Close FF
    If there is a file called places.sqlite.corrupt:<br/>
    Rename places.sqlite to places.sqlite.old<br/>
    Rename places.sqlite.corrupt to places.sqlite<br/>
    Restart FF
    And if there isn't well...sorry =/. You might want to save these files elsewhere too just in case before renaming them so they can be replaced.

  • Start backups from scratch

    I've got a Time Capsule and want to start a new full backup of my Mac keeping a copy of my previous series. Since it seems that it's not possible to partition a TC an alternative solution AFAIU could be renaming the corresponding sparsebundle file.
    The steps I would do are:
    1. Stop TM.
    2. Change TM's drive to None.
    3. In Finder, rename MacXXXmacaddressXXX.sparsebundle to, say, ....sparsebundleOLD
    4. Restart TM.
    5. Point TM's drive to TC.
    (or should be step 5 before step 4?)
    Later on, when some backup cycles are performed I could delete the old sparsebundle, and if something goes wrong with the full backup backup I could fall back (n.p.i.) to the old one.
    Am I on track or have missed something important? Is it a safe procedure? (*)
    I don't mind to experiment a bit, but on backups I want to double check first.
    Thanks in advance,
    Hernan.
    (*) You don't need to add a disclaimer, it's implicit.
    (**) ENVIRONMENT: MacBook 13.3 Unibody. SL 10.6.1. Time Capsule from June 2009.

    Update:
    It's possible to reuse an old .sparsebundle file so long you rename it to the same name TM is using in your current backup. In this case beware of disk space as TM will try to bring your old backup file up today. As expected, you'll find a "time hole" during the days the backup wasn't active. Nevertheless, you can navigate through it with TM's user interface without hassles.
    In summary:
    . You don't have to worry that one day TM will fill up the Time Capsule. Follow the previous recipe and it will restart over your backup procedures with a clean init.
    . Later on, when you'll feel confident with your new backups, you can drop the old renamed .sparsebundle file if you want to free disk space, but you may keep it too. Swap their names, and you'll be able to browse your old backup with TM's Star Wars user interface.
    . Or just keep the ".sparsebundle" extension -but with another base name to avoid any conflict with your current backup-, mount it and browse the virtual disk within the Finder.
    . I don't know if the sparsebundle file is burnable on a DVD.
    . If you restart the backups over I recommend to connect your Mac through a Ethernet cable, as after step 5 TM will do a full backup.
    . I *highly recommend* that after you upgraded your OS and all your *third party software* to SL, restart your backup from scratch. You'll be able to save a lot of space!
